The Challenge
Building an offline-first software solution handling large volumes of PHI that has to be measured and synced perfectly — in a high-regulation industry, with a hardware device in the loop.
The app runs offline-first and carries a heavy load of PHI, where every reading has to be captured accurately and stay perfectly in sync. On top of that, a hardware device feeds the data and has to be handled reliably — all inside an industry with strict regulations and standards, where there's no margin for a lost or mismeasured reading.

The Solution
A scalable, offline-first architecture engineered to move sensitive health data between hardware, app, and backend with clinical-grade reliability.
The system was architected around the hardware from the ground up, so the device, the software layer, and the backend operate as one reliable pipeline rather than three parts stitched together. Every layer was designed for scale and for the integrity demands of regulated health data — resilient under real-world conditions, and built to extend as the product and its clinical footprint grow.
